Sri Lanka parliament votes to fire impeached police chief

Aug 5, 2025 - 20:22
 0  0
Sri Lanka parliament votes to fire impeached police chief
The move comes after a commission found Deshabandu Tennakoon guilty of gross abuse of power.

What's Your Reaction?

Like Like 0
Dislike Dislike 0
Love Love 0
Funny Funny 0
Angry Angry 0
Sad Sad 0
Wow Wow 0